Teresa Sartore
Head of the International Press Office

Teresa Sartore is Head of the International Press Office at Lightbox. She was born and bred in Venice and since 2005 she has undertaken several research and art projects, and has since gone on to specialise in Communications and Contemporary Art.

She holds an MA in Anthropology from SOAS School of Oriental and African Studies, London University. She worked as Research Assistant at Heidelberg University (2009-2013) and Visiting Researcher at the Université Libre de Bruxelles (2011-2013).

In 2015 she was the Artistic Director of PRISMA Human Rights Photo Contest, organised by the Global Campus of Human Rights in collaboration with Lightbox. In 2016 and 2017 she was a member and artistic curator at ISOLAB, Photography Research Centre.

She is currently Media and Communication Consultant for the Department of Asian and North Africa Studies (since 2019) and the Department of Humanities (since 2021), Ca’ Foscari University.
